Just got back from a great trip this weekend. We spent 2 nights in langdale, the lakes. Beautiful place. Slightly windy when it wants to be Went with two friends matt and mike. Impressed with myself because I used everything in my pack that I had taken, and needed no other than a wee knife, which mike had on him anyway. Still weighed in at 13kg and was a bit of a killer on the steeper inclines so I will be on the look out for a load of new kit now
we arrived at the hotel parking at 8.30, and pretty much set of asap as it was pretty much dark. We trecked up stickle gyhll to stickle tarn where we camped for the first night. The next morning we went up inbetween harrison stickle and pavey ark, past the pike of stickle, crossed stake pass and over gavel moor to angle tarn below esk pike where we had a wee break, then down puddy gyhll past great end to sprinkling tarn where we stayed the night, looking over to great gable. Lovely little tarn, teeming with fish. The next morning we set off back to angle tarn then down rosett ghyll and mickleden back to the car. Great weekend! enjoy the pics.
